Jll is seeking a Regional Critical Engineering Manager to ensure 100% uptime of critical engineering assets across its portfolio in the UK and Europe. This role includes managing technical performance and service delivery for various critical systems.
The ideal candidate will have relevant experience, certifications, and a track record of leading multi-skilled engineering teams. The position requires extensive travel and strong leadership skills to mentor and manage contractors effectively while maintaining compliance with industry standards.
